"""Factory helpers for node executors.
Create and manage executors for different node types.
"""
from typing import Dict
from runtime.node.executor.base import NodeExecutor, ExecutionContext
from runtime.node.registry import iter_node_registrations
class NodeExecutorFactory:
"""Factory class that instantiates executors for every node type."""
@staticmethod
def create_executors(context: ExecutionContext, subgraphs: dict = None) -> Dict[str, NodeExecutor]:
"""Create executors for every registered node type.
Args:
context: Shared execution context
subgraphs: Mapping of subgraph nodes (used by Subgraph executors)
Returns:
Mapping from node type to executor instance
"""
subgraphs = subgraphs or {}
executors: Dict[str, NodeExecutor] = {}
for name, registration in iter_node_registrations().items():
executors[name] = registration.build_executor(context, subgraphs=subgraphs)
return executors
@staticmethod
def create_executor(
node_type: str,
context: ExecutionContext,
subgraphs: dict = None
) -> NodeExecutor:
"""Create an executor for the requested node type.
Args:
node_type: Registered node type name
context: Shared execution context
subgraphs: Mapping of subgraph nodes (used by Subgraph executors)
Returns:
Executor instance for the requested type
Raises:
ValueError: If the node type is not supported
"""
subgraphs = subgraphs or {}
registrations = iter_node_registrations()
if node_type not in registrations:
raise ValueError(f"Unsupported node type: {node_type}")
return registrations[node_type].build_executor(context, subgraphs=subgraphs)
